Subject: [PHP-WIN] Compiling PHP with MS SQL Server Driver for PHP support

Hi.

Compiling using VC9 Express Edition.

I'm ending up with a php_sqlsrv.dll of 88KB

The VC9 x86 nts version supplied by MS (php_sqlsrv_53_nts_vc9.dll) is 227KB.

If it had been just a few bytes, then OK, but to be over 40% smaller
is a significant difference.

Any ideas?

As far as I can tell, it all works just fine too!
